Parking lots were made for parking, right? Well yes, but on this misty morning 8 Harrisburg Pax found another use for The Ridge parking lot. It involved burpee broad jumps, and several other sweat producing movements. This is what the Pax did:

Mosey through parking lot with high knees and butt kickers

Warm-o-rama

Side straddle hop, Wind Mill, Cotton Pickers, Merkins, Mountain Climbers, Air Squats

The Thang

Starting at corner of parking lot nearest the school entrance……repeat this set of four across all the parking lanes and stop when you reach the driving lane that separates the two parking lots (total of 9 reps……so 9 burpee broad jumps at the end)

  1. Run one length of the parking lot (either straight length or make a u-turn to next lane if starting in the middle)
  2. Do: 10 x merkins, 10 x LBC, & 5 x WW II Situps
  3. Back peddle half the length of the parking lot
  4. Do 1 burpee broad jump…then increase this by 1 each time this set is repeated

Early finishers pick up the six and continue until all finish with 9 burpee broad jumps
